I have a severe performance problem when connecting a M$-Client PC with a
Bootdisk and TCP/IP-Stack to my Samba server.
Both machines are linked via a 100Mbit crosslink connection.
The server is running a SuSE Linux 7.2 with Kernel 2.4.19, the smb-fs and
the NIC is compiled into the kernel.
The Client uses a DOS 6.2 bootdisk with the M$ TCPIP-stack version 1.02.
All M$ drivers load fine, the 'net use' command works too.
Then I start Symantecs 'ghost' to create an image from the clients HD and
put it to the used Samba share on the server.
The Performance is poooor (<1Mbyte/min), tests with a W2K server on the same
hardware showed better values (>200Mbyte/min)   :-(  .
What can I do to improve this poor samba throughput???
